Harbin Ice Festival
The annual Harbin International Ice and Snow Sculpture Festival has been held since 1963. The festival is now one of the most popular local festivals in China, as well as one of the largest ice and snow spectacles in the world, making Harbin a favorite destination for numerous tourists from home and abroad to spend their winter holidays.
A highlight of the festival is the ice lantern and sculpture exhibitions, which provide visitors a good opportunity to appreciate a galaxy of unique ice and snow art. Thousands of exquisitely-made ice lanterns, ice carvings and snow sculptures grace the snow-covered parks, public squares and major streets, turning the city into a dreamlike world of pure whiteness and gleaming crystal.
In addition to the famous local and international ice lantern and snow sculpture exhibitions and contests, winter swimming, ice hockey and alpine and cross-country skiing contests are held. There are also painting, calligraphy and photo exhibitions as well as a film festival. Moreover, there are performances of folk songs and dances and wedding ceremonies that are performed on ice. Trade fairs are also held.
